Whispers of the Ocean: Discover the Enchantment of Lahaina's Coastal Charms
Lahaina, Hawaii, is a captivating blend of rich history and breathtaking natural beauty, set against the stunning backdrop of the Pacific Ocean. Once the bustling capital of the Hawaiian Kingdom, this charming town is renowned for its vibrant arts scene and historic sites, including the iconic Banyan Tree and the Lahaina Historic District. Stroll along the picturesque Front Street, where local galleries and eateries beckon. The nearby beaches, such as Kaanapali, offer pristine sands and crystal-clear waters for sunbathing and water sports. With its romantic sunsets and warm Aloha spirit, Lahaina is an enchanting escape for all.

Where to stay near Lahaina
In Kaanapali, Napili, and Kapalua, each offers unique attractions: Kaanapali boasts vibrant beach life, excellent snorkeling, and diverse dining; Napili enchants with its stunning sunsets, scuba diving, and seafood delights; Kapalua provides a romantic retreat with golf and scenic hikes. For first-time visitors, Kaanapali is the ideal base.
- KaanapaliOpens in a new window: Kaanapali is a top choice with a lively coastal vibe, offering a mix of beach relaxation and vibrant shopping and spa experiences. Enjoy the beauty of Kaanapali Beach and the dramatic views at Black Rock, or simply savour the tropical sunsets that define this area. It's a great spot if you love a touch of the sea combined with exciting excursions and local dining experiences.
- NapiliOpens in a new window: Napili provides a more laid-back atmosphere perfect for those who enjoy a close connection with the sea and nature. With a focus on snorkeling and scuba diving, visitors can explore the underwater world, while the serene beaches and tropical sunsets create a peaceful retreat. This area is ideal for travellers seeking a quieter environment with a dash of adventure in its scenic coastal setting.
- KapaluaOpens in a new window: Kapalua charms with its romantic and relaxing coastal ambience, combining pristine beaches with opportunities for snorkeling and diving. The area is well-known for its beautiful sunsets and offers a unique blend of leisure and scenic hikes, making it a wonderful choice for couples and those in search of a tranquil escape. It's a perfect retreat where natural beauty meets serene luxury.

Best time to go to Lahaina
Lahaina experiences its lowest average temperatures in February to March, at 72.7°F (22.6°C), while September is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.1°F (25.6°C). December is usually the wettest month. March, April, and July are the peak travel months in Lahaina,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. On the other hand, October to December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
